How Do You Give Thanks?


Thanksgiving is a time of gratitude and family for many. It is a time for saying thanks. During this holiday, families come together to show appreciation and support. How do you show thanks? Here are some ideas on ways to give back and show love for others.

  1. Thank someone for just being themselves.

  2. Donate to charity.

  3. Write someone you know a note of appreciation.

  4. Visit a hospital.

  5. Give a loved one a hug that is 5 seconds longer than usual.

  6. Volunteer at an animal shelter.

  7. Volunteer at a senior center.

  8. Catch someone doing something they usually do, but make an extra point of thanking them this time around.

  9. Plant a tree.

  10. If you know of someone who will be alone for Thanksgiving, invite them to your gathering.

  11. Make a centerpiece for your Thanksgiving dinner table for others to enjoy.

  12. Start a gratitude journal.

  13. Offer to do the dishes!
